public class OrcStripeMetadata extends Object implements ConsumerStripeMetadata
| Constructor and Description |
|---|
OrcStripeMetadata(OrcBatchKey stripeKey,
org.apache.orc.OrcProto.StripeFooter footer,
org.apache.orc.impl.OrcIndex orcIndex,
org.apache.orc.StripeInformation stripe) |
| Modifier and Type | Method and Description |
|---|---|
org.apache.orc.OrcProto.BloomFilterIndex[] |
getBloomFilterIndexes() |
org.apache.orc.OrcProto.Stream.Kind[] |
getBloomFilterKinds() |
List<org.apache.orc.OrcProto.ColumnEncoding> |
getEncodings() |
org.apache.orc.impl.OrcIndex |
getIndex() |
OrcBatchKey |
getKey() |
long |
getRowCount() |
org.apache.orc.OrcProto.RowIndexEntry |
getRowIndexEntry(int colIx,
int rgIx) |
org.apache.orc.OrcProto.RowIndex[] |
getRowIndexes() |
List<org.apache.orc.OrcProto.Stream> |
getStreams() |
int |
getStripeIx() |
String |
getWriterTimezone() |
void |
resetRowIndex() |
boolean |
supportsRowIndexes() |
String |
toString() |
public OrcStripeMetadata(OrcBatchKey stripeKey, org.apache.orc.OrcProto.StripeFooter footer, org.apache.orc.impl.OrcIndex orcIndex, org.apache.orc.StripeInformation stripe) throws IOException
IOExceptionpublic int getStripeIx()
getStripeIx in interface ConsumerStripeMetadatapublic org.apache.orc.OrcProto.RowIndex[] getRowIndexes()
getRowIndexes in interface ConsumerStripeMetadatapublic org.apache.orc.OrcProto.Stream.Kind[] getBloomFilterKinds()
public org.apache.orc.OrcProto.BloomFilterIndex[] getBloomFilterIndexes()
public List<org.apache.orc.OrcProto.ColumnEncoding> getEncodings()
getEncodings in interface ConsumerStripeMetadatapublic List<org.apache.orc.OrcProto.Stream> getStreams()
public String getWriterTimezone()
getWriterTimezone in interface ConsumerStripeMetadatapublic OrcBatchKey getKey()
public long getRowCount()
getRowCount in interface ConsumerStripeMetadatapublic void resetRowIndex()
public org.apache.orc.OrcProto.RowIndexEntry getRowIndexEntry(int colIx,
int rgIx)
getRowIndexEntry in interface ConsumerStripeMetadatapublic boolean supportsRowIndexes()
supportsRowIndexes in interface ConsumerStripeMetadatapublic org.apache.orc.impl.OrcIndex getIndex()
Copyright © 2019 The Apache Software Foundation. All Rights Reserved.